Susannah "Susie" Bright is an American writer, speaker, teacher, audio-show host, and performer, all on the subject of sexuality. She is one of the first writers/activists referred to as a sex-positive feminist

| Award | Year |
|---|---|
| Lambda Literary Award for Photography/Visual Arts (Nothing But the Girl: The Blatant Lesbian Image) | 1996 |
| Lambda Literary Award for Lesbian Nonfiction (Susie Sexpert's Lesbian Sex World) | 1990 |
| Lambda Literary Award for Humor (Susie Sexpert's Lesbian Sex World) | 1990 |
